Carbon fiber subway trains complete trial run

A carbon fiber subway train of six carriages successfully completed its trial run in Qingdao, East China's Shandong province, on Wednesday.

Dubbed the "future subway train", it uses advanced technologies and new materials, according to its developer CRRC Qingdao Sifang Co.

The carriage body, bogie frame, driver's cabin and equipment compartment are made of carbon fiber composite materials, which make the train 13 percent lighter than traditional subway train, said Ding Sansan, deputy chief engineer of CRRC Qingdao Sifang Co. Silicon carbide inverter and permanent magnet synchronous motor are used in the hauling system, which save energy by 15 percent, said Ding.

The windows in the train are touch panels. Passengers can watch videos and news by touching the windows.

The train is automatic driven. With intelligent monitoring and warning system, it can realize on-route fault early warning and initiate repair work when needed, compared with planned repair work on traditional subway trains.

The train can run at a speed of up to 140 kilometers per hour, faster than traditional subway train. What's more, it runs more stably because it uses full active suspension technology for the first time.

Thanks to the new sound-proof materials, the noise within carriages is five decibel lower than traditional carriages.

The train is also adaptable to bad operational environment. It can run smoothly in high or low temperatures, on high altitude, small-radius curves and big ramps.

The train is expected to undergo track test in July.
